    You have to use a gel for it to work, for sure. You can buy generic personal lubricant (similar to ky jelly) at any store, just make sure it is WATER-based. Anything oil based can damage the wand from what I understand. I used the generic Wal-Mart brand stuff and it worked wonderfully.

    I use aloe for mine and it works great. KY's original formula works as well but aloe is cheaper. But you need the gel for it to work properly.
